DHCP (DHCP setting)

DHCP (Dynamic Host Configuration Protocol) is the protocol that assigns the information required to establish a network connection when a host attempts to connect to the network (Internet). This information includes the IP address of the local node and the default router (the router in the host's own network system) and the DNS (Domain Name System) server. DHCP is an extension of the BOOTP (Bootstrap) startup protocol.

1Press Z while >TCP/IP On > is displayed.

2Press U or V repeatedly until >>DHCP appears.

3Press [OK]. A blinking question mark (?) appears.

>>IP Address 000.000.000.000

4Select On or Off using U or V.

5Press [OK].

6Press [MENU]. The display returns to Ready.

IP Address (IP address setting)

An IP address is the address of a network device such as a computer and is included in IP packets as needed for the sending and receiving of Internet data (IP packets). (IP addresses can be either destination addresses or source addresses.)

Specifically, an IP address is a bit string consisting of a host address (or host section) that identifies a computer (host) connected to the Internet and a network address (or network section) that identifies the network to which that computer belongs (or more specifically, the computer's network interface). Bit strings (IP addresses) that are unique throughout the entire Internet system are allocated to each computer or interface.

The IP addresses currently used on the Internet (IPv4) have a fixed length of 32 bits.

Note When you enter the IP address, be sure to set the DHCP setting to Off.

1Press Z while >TCP/IP On > is displayed.

2Press U or V repeatedly until >>IP Address appears.

3Press [OK]. A blinking cursor (_) appears.

4Press U or V to increase or decrease, respectively, the value at the blinking cursor. You can set any value between 000 and 255. Use Y and Z to move the cursor right and left.

5Display the desired IP address and press [OK].

6Press [MENU]. The display returns to Ready.

The Kyocera FS-3920DN is a robust and efficient monochrome laser printer designed specifically for small to medium-sized businesses. This multifunctional printer is known for its reliability and high-performance printing capabilities, making it an ideal choice for organizations that require fast, high-quality document output.

One of the standout features of the FS-3920DN is its impressive printing speed. It can produce up to 40 pages per minute (ppm), which significantly enhances productivity, especially in busy office environments where time is of the essence. The first printout is delivered in as little as 5.9 seconds, ensuring that users spend minimal time waiting for documents.

The printer is equipped with a dual-side printing option, which not only helps to save paper but also reduces printing costs. This automatic duplex printing feature is an attractive benefit for companies looking to adopt environmentally friendly practices.

In terms of print quality, the FS-3920DN boasts a resolution of 1200 x 1200 dpi, producing sharp and clear text along with detailed graphics. This makes it suitable for a variety of documentation needs, from simple text documents to more complex reports and presentations.

The printer utilizes Kyocera's advanced toner technology, which results in a longer lifespan and lower cost per page. The eco-friendly ECOSYS technology ensures that the printer is not only efficient but also sustainable, thereby contributing to reduced environmental impact through lower waste generation.

Connectivity options are extensive, with USB and Ethernet ports available for seamless integration into existing networks. Additionally, the FS-3920DN is compatible with mobile printing options, allowing users to print directly from their smartphones and tablets. This flexibility is particularly beneficial in modern office settings where mobility is a key factor.

Moreover, the FS-3920DN's compact design enhances its usability in limited spaces without compromising functionality. Its user-friendly control panel simplifies operation, making it accessible even for those with minimal technical skills.

Overall, the Kyocera FS-3920DN stands out in the competitive landscape of office printers with its blend of high-speed performance, quality output, cost-efficiency, and environmental consideration, making it a smart investment for any enterprise focused on enhancing productivity while maintaining a commitment to sustainability.
